SelectSingleNode是一个用于在XML文档中选择单个节点的方法。它是一种在云计算领域中常用的技术,用于解析和操作XML数据。
X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,它具有自我描述性和可扩展性的特点。在云计算中,XML常用于数据交换和配置文件的存储。
SelectSingleNode方法用于在XML文档中选择符合指定条件的单个节点。它接受一个XPath表达式作为参数,该表达式用于指定节点的路径和条件。通过使用XPath表达式,可以灵活地定位和选择XML文档中的节点。
优势:
- 灵活性:XPath表达式可以根据需要定位和选择XML文档中的节点,具有很高的灵活性。
- 简洁性:通过使用SelectSingleNode方法,可以简洁地实现对XML文档中节点的选择和操作。
- 效率:SelectSingleNode方法只返回符合条件的第一个节点,因此在处理大型XML文档时可以提高效率。
应用场景:
- 数据解析:在云计算中,XML常用于数据的传输和存储。通过使用SelectSingleNode方法,可以方便地解析和提取XML数据中的特定节点。
- 配置文件:许多云计算应用程序使用XML文件作为配置文件。通过使用SelectSingleNode方法,可以读取和修改配置文件中的节点信息。
腾讯云相关产品:
腾讯云提供了一系列与云计算相关的产品和服务,其中包括与XML数据处理相关的产品。以下是一些相关产品的介绍:
- 腾讯云对象存储(COS):腾讯云对象存储是一种高可用、高可靠、低成本的云存储服务。它可以用于存储和管理XML文件,并提供了简单易用的API来操作XML数据。
- 腾讯云函数计算(SCF):腾讯云函数计算是一种无服务器计算服务,可以在云端运行代码。通过使用SCF,可以编写自定义的XML数据处理函数,并在云端进行执行。
- 腾讯云云数据库MongoDB(TencentDB for MongoDB):腾讯云云数据库MongoDB是一种高性能、可扩展的NoSQL数据库服务。它支持存储和查询XML数据,并提供了丰富的查询语言和索引功能。
以上是腾讯云提供的一些与XML数据处理相关的产品和服务。通过使用这些产品,可以方便地处理和管理XML数据,并实现各种云计算应用场景。
参考链接:
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云函数计算(SCF):https://cloud.tencent.com/product/scf
- 腾讯云云数据库MongoDB(TencentDB for MongoDB):https://cloud.tencent.com/product/mongodb